Boping Wu is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Plant Science and Biochem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Boping Wu has authored 17 papers receiving a total of 452 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Molecular Biology, 10 papers in Plant Science and 4 papers in Biochemistry. Recurrent topics in Boping Wu's work include Plant biochemistry and biosynthesis (8 papers), Plant Gene Expression Analysis (7 papers) and Postharvest Quality and Shelf Life Management (4 papers). Boping Wu is often cited by papers focused on Plant biochemistry and biosynthesis (8 papers), Plant Gene Expression Analysis (7 papers) and Postharvest Quality and Shelf Life Management (4 papers). Boping Wu coll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Nepal. Boping Wu's co-authors include Bo Zhang, Kunsong Chen, Xiangmei Cao, Hongru Liu, Jie Gao, Xiaohong Liu, Yaying Xu, Changjie Xu, Bo Zhang and Harry J. Klee and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, PLANT PHYSIOLOGY and Food Chemistry.
